red burrito
St Louis, MO
Red Burrito in St. Louis, MO, offers a vibrant and delicious menu focused on fresh ingredients and flavorful burritos. With a casual atmosphere, it's the perfect spot for a quick bite or a relaxed meal with friends. Guests can customize their orders to suit their tastes, making every visit a unique experience.
Generated from this place's information
See a problem?
You might also like
Partial Data by Foursquare.


